WebFeb 22, 2024 · Rex Rats. Curly-coated rats have been bred in the laboratory and in the fancy since at least 1976. There is one common gene—the dominant rex gene—that shows up frequently in the hobby but there are five and possibly more genes that cause rexing in rats that have been documented in laboratory settings.
